Historical Context: From Manual to Mechanical Precision
Historically, UK fishing vessels relied heavily on manual techniques and simple gear mechanisms. The introduction of mechanical reels in the late 19th and early 20th centuries marked a revolution, enabling fishermen to handle larger catch volumes with increased efficiency. Early reel designs focused on robustness and simplicity, with wooden and early metal models serving the industry well into the mid-20th century.
However, rapid technological developments in materials science and engineering introduced more sophisticated reel mechanisms. The adoption of sealed bearings, corrosion-resistant materials, and ergonomic designs led to notable improvements in performance. Today, reel technology interventions aim at optimizing bait presentation, improving retrieval smoothness, and extending operational lifespan, especially under the harsh conditions of UK waters.
The Role of Innovation in Modern Reel Development
In recent years, the fishing industry has shifted towards greater sustainability, using lighter, more efficient equipment to minimise ecological impact. The advent of digital components and refined mechanical systems has allowed for features like adjustable drag systems, hybrid materials, and electronic controls. As a result, modern reels can better withstand the saline environment of British waters, leading to longer service life and less frequent replacements.
Furthermore, in the competitive sphere of commercial fishing, even marginal improvements in gear can translate into significant economic gains. The emphasis is now on precision-engineered reels that decrease manual effort, reduce fatigue, and increase the reliability of catch retrieval. These factors are particularly vital given the regulatory constraints in UK fisheries aimed at ensuring sustainable harvests while maintaining livelihood security for local communities.
